54132DM Description
The 54132DM is a high-performance NAND gate IC designed by National Semiconductor, featuring robust technical specifications and versatile applications. This logic IC chip is part of the 54132 series and is housed in a 14-pin CERDIP package, making it suitable for through-hole mounting. The device operates within a supply voltage range of 4.5V to 5.5V and is optimized for a maximum propagation delay of 22ns at 5V with a load capacitance of 15pF. The 54132DM is equipped with Schmitt Trigger technology, enhancing its noise immunity and signal conditioning capabilities. It supports two input logic levels: low at 1.1V and high at 2V, ensuring compatibility with a wide range of digital systems. The IC comprises four independent NAND gate circuits, each with two inputs, providing a total of eight input connections. The quiescent current is limited to a maximum of 40 mA, while the output current capabilities are rated at 800µA for high and 16mA for low states. The 54132DM is moisture-sensitive with a level of 3, requiring 168 hours of protection, and is classified under ECCN EAR99 and HTSUS 8542.39.0001. This product is currently active and available in bulk packaging.
